Elie Tass

  • Share on Facebook
  • Share on Twitter

Elie Tass was born in 1981 in Belgium. Engaging in different sports in his youth - ranging from soccer to martial arts to powertraining - dancing came into play only later on, gradually, starting with ballet, and later breakdance. After 2 years of physical education at the University of Ghent, he started out on a 3-year dance training at the HID (Higher Institute for Dance) in Lier, Belgium. In addition to a series of creations with Thierry Smits and Marc Bogaerts and some small work of his own, he participated in Tannhäuser (an opera by Richard Wagner) for Troubleyn/Jan Fabre while he was still at school. In 2006 he started working with les ballets C de la B/Alain Platel for the creation of VSPRS. That meeting was continued for another four years, with mainly two creations, pitié! and Out of context - for Pina.

In 2011 Ross McCormack - they met at les Ballets C de la B during VSPRS - invited Elie to Australia to join him to work on a short co-creation for Queensland-based contemporary dance company Dancenorth. As part of a double bill they made (sic).
